1. Telegraph Island – A Historic Hidden Paradise

One of the most fascinating spots in Musandam, Telegraph Island is surrounded by crystal-clear waters and dramatic cliffs.

Telegraph Island Snorkeling

Why it’s special: Built by the British in the 1860s as a telegraph relay station, it is now a peaceful snorkeling paradise. The calm waters are perfect for swimming and exploring vibrant marine life.

3. Hidden Fjords of Khasab – The “Norway of Arabia”

Often called the “Norway of Arabia,” the fjords near Khasab are among the most breathtaking landscapes in the Middle East.

Landscape: Towering limestone cliffs
Waters: Quiet, mirror-like bays
Authenticity: Remote fishing villages
Experience: Rare escape from city life
